This topic may have been discussed before,but I couldn't find any reference to this topic so here goes I am using FTM / 9 and am having trouble when it comes to typing in the dates ...ex March  3 1876....  and the program then write March 3 1876/1877.  How do I correct this as it is frustrating me especially when I have certificates giving me the right dates. Do others have this problem and how do you overcome it  help......

Try going to FILE, then Preferences, then DATES and check the entry for double dates this should be 1752 by default

Hope that is the answer
